Convertible crib
Convertible cribs are a unique piece of children's furniture designed with adaptability in mind. They let parents transform a bed into different types of beds as their child grows, ensuring that one investment lasts from toddler to full-size. These beds are a favorite among many parents because they offer more flexibility than standard cribs, and also save money over the long term because they do not require separate beds for each stage of development.
When you are choosing a convertible crib, ensure that it meets the national safety standards. This means avoiding models that have drop-side rails, as they have been shown to be a danger for infant children. A convertible crib should also be easy to clean and have an easily-movable mattress. The MONEHANE crib is JPMA-certified to meet CPSC, ASTM and CPSC safety standards.

Toddler bed
If your child has outgrown their crib, it is often time to switch to a toddler bed. This is an important stage in their development, and you should wait until your child is ready for the transition. You can cause problems by rushing them into bed. They might not be ready to sleep alone or they may have difficulty sleeping and could be annoyed by the constant interruptions to rock them or change their beds. This can cause everyone problems in the long run.
Whether your baby is ready or not, it is important to be prepared to enforce the rules when they are in a bed for toddlers. Also, look around their room to make sure there aren't any items they can climb or get tangled in, such as curtains, drapes or furniture. You might want to install an entrance on the top of the stairs to stop them from running away and getting into trouble.
Toddler beds come in a variety of designs and materials. Some are made of wood to give the warmth and comfort of a study while others are made from metal for durability. They are also available in a variety of colors to match with any nursery decor. Some come with a soft headboard that is cushioned for comfort while others have side rails with low heights to aid your child in learning to sleep independently.
The majority of toddler beds can be used with the crib mattress. If you decide to go with a mattress that is not included, make sure that it fits perfectly into the bed frame. There should be no gaps between the mattress and the frame in which your child may be able to get stuck.
It is beneficial to get your toddler used to their new bed several months before the baby is born. This will allow them to be comfortable in their new bed, and reduce the likelihood that they will resent their baby for removing their crib.
